The Majura Parkway is the single largest road infrastructure project undertaken by the ACT to date.

When completed, it will link the Federal Highway at its northern end to the Monaro Highway at its southern end.

Broad statistics for the Majura Parkway project are:

  • 11.5 km long, dual carriageway and will have speed limit of 100 km/hr
  • 2 x 3.5 metres traffic lanes, a 2.5 m roadside shoulder and a 1m offside shoulder 10 bridges, including 250 metre twin bridges over the Molonglo River
  • Designed to carry 40,000 vehicles a day including 6,000 trucks

The Majura Parkway project will provide a wide range of benefits including:

  • improved traffic flow and safety;
  • additional capacity on the ACT road network;
  • reduced travel times;
  • improved access to the Majura Valley;
  • dedicated on-road cycle lanes to encourage cycling;
  • improved access to the national and regional freight route; and
  • supporting infrastructure for the Canberra International Airport to become a major international freight and commuter hub.
